Default Question about the Lock Icon

If this has already been answered I apologize. I didn't see it.
I have Windows 7 Pro x64. I have been beta testing for quite awhile now and have v.8.0.123 running with Sandboxie v. 3.62 for 64 bit.
I can get the Lock Icon if I run outside of the sandbox but that kind of defeats the purpose.
When I run sandboxed I get no Lock Icon which leaves me feeling much less secured.
Is there a simple fix for this?

As mentioned in the other threads, you could probably get around this by only browsing with an unsandboxed browser when on banking/purchasing websites. Those sites would be unlikely to infect you (and the rest of WSA's protection will still apply) but it will give WSA the ability to communicate in and out of the browser to facilitate its Identity Shield protection accurately.
